     Your Committee on Conference on the disagreeing vote of the House of Representatives to the amendments proposed by the Senate in H.B. No. 1483, H.D. 1, S.D. 1, entitled:

 

"A BILL FOR AN ACT RELATING TO FIREWORKS,"

 

having met, and after full and free discussion, has agreed to recommend and does recommend to the respective Houses the final passage of this bill in an amended form.

 

     The purpose of this measure is to:

 

     (1)  Establish various criminal offenses and penalties related to fireworks or articles pyrotechnic;

 

     (2)  Amend and establish various definitions and penalties for fireworks offenses, including establishing heightened penalties under certain circumstances;

 

     (3)  Incorporate fireworks infractions into the existing adjudication process for traffic and emergency period infractions; and

 

     (4)  Appropriate funds.

 

     Your Committee on Conference has amended this measure by:

 

     (1)  Providing that the limitation on the number of permits a person may obtain does not apply to permits for aerial devices, articles pyrotechnic, or display fireworks;

 

     (2)  Deleting the appropriation; and

 

     (3)  Making technical, nonsubstantive amendments for the purposes of clarity, consistency, and style.

 

     As affirmed by the record of votes of the managers of your Committee on Conference that is attached to this report, your Committee on Conference is in accord with the intent and purpose of H.B. No. 1483, H.D. 1, S.D. 1, as amended herein, and recommends that it pass Final Reading in the form attached hereto as H.B. No. 1483, H.D. 1, S.D. 1, C.D. 1.
